here's a ridiculous machine. a fun experiment.
i introduce to you the EM DASH DESTROYER 4001. a reputed industrial-grade punctuation removal system, first manufactured in 1982 by BASEPURPOSE HEAVY INDUSTRIES. known for its unmatched reliability and dramatic visual effects, this machine has been the industry standard for em dash obliteration for over four decades.
the concept is simple and timely. ai tools overuse the em dash. it's not just in text they write from scratch, it's also in text you ask them to refine. the interesting thing about the em dash (—) is that it's not grammatically necessary. you can almost always replace it with other punctuation and your sentence will still be correct. the app replaces it with a plain comma.
it's become a telltale sign of unedited ai writing. to be clear, there's no notion here that somehow using ai for writing is bad, we've been using ai to enhance writing for a long time, it's easier and more precise now. but this overuse of em dashes just makes writing feel mechanical. people who read a lot notice it immediately. we're not trying to hide anything, just making the writing cleaner while having some fun with fire and industrial machinery.
tech stack: Vue 3, TypeScript, HTML5 Canvas for the particle effects. all the fire, smoke, and crushing animations are done with vanilla canvas, no libraries. the machine shakes, the chimney puffs smoke, and you can adjust destruction intensity from 25-100%.
